Job description

We are seeking a skilled Low Current Technician to join our team full-time. The ideal candidate will have a strong background in low current systems and the ability to work independently and in a team.

Key Responsibilities:

- Install, maintain, and troubleshoot low current systems, including CCTV, access control, fire alarms, and structured cabling.

- Conduct site surveys and assessments to determine client solutions.

- Collaborate with team members for timely project completion.

- Stay updated on industry developments and low current technology advancements.

- Provide technical support and assistance to clients.

- Perform maintenance and corrective services.

- Follow all safety protocols and regulations on job sites.

- Document all work performed and maintain accurate records.

Qualifications:

- High school diploma or equivalent, technical degree preferred.

- Minimum of 2 years of experience in low current systems installation and maintenance.

- Knowledge of CCTV, access control, fire alarms, and structured cabling.

- Familiarity with industry standards and regulations.

- Ability to read and interpret technical drawings and schematics.

- Strong troubleshooting and problem-solving skills.

- Ability to work independently and as part of a team.

- Valid driver's license and reliable transportation.

- Willingness to work flexible hours and travel to job sites as needed.
